I had only been here once before, years ago, so I thought I’d give it another try. I was dissatisfied and disappointed again…the fried mushrooms were pretty good as long as they were hot when you ate them. The crab Rangoon filling was runny and tasteless and the wrappers were tough. I ordered kushi (what I went there for) chow mein and fried rice. When my plate arrived, the kushi was tiny…one piece of chicken and one piece of onion and it was bland. The chow mien was this neon green, shiny glop with crumbles of some kind of meat. I was expecting noodles, not a blob of disgusting looking food. Can’t tell you how it was because I didn’t eat it. The fried rice was tasteless as well…one bite of the mushy stuff was more than enough for me. It’s like everything was made days before and reheated or kept warm under lights. I will not darken that doorstep again. Lesson learned.

Decent experience. It's limited on the veg menu, but their sauted veggies are pretty good (especially, the mushrooms). I would recommend sprinkling some pepper on that for better taste. The yaki soba (soft noodles with pan fried veggies and pork/chicken) was good too - and even better with the duck sauce. It's pretty crowded on a weekend (this town is pretty convenient for Mt. Washington tourists), so the wait times for your food are a little on the higher side. And no dessert options 🙁

In the small town of Gorham, NH, Yokohama is the token Asian restaurant with canned goods for sale at restaurant prices. Pictured is the Osoba (literally ramen in a bag), Hibachi Platter for two (all frozen goods that are fried to order), Sauteed Vegetables (the only decent item; tasted like the inside of an egg roll at your typical Chinese takeaway minus the fried wrap). We ordered much more for a table of 6 but the consensus was the same all-around... McDonald's down the street would've been better.
